    bummer on the single status fyi - Rides that have 'Single rider' is a good way to cut your wait to almost nothing in some cases. If you like trains, you could ride the behind the locomotive in a special seat(Tender car) around the park. just ask nicely at the Main Street Train Station when they have several trains running and they have the EP Ripley locomotive or C.K. Holiday in use.
